Optoisolators, also known as optocouplers, are isolating elements that largely use a light emitting diode (LED) to transfer electrical signals from input circuits to output circuits. The FOD2742CV optoisolator is one of the most widely used in industrial applications – allowing for the complete isolation of input to output circuits, with a high degree of safety. Working Principle

The FOD2742CV optoisolator consists of a light emitting diode (LED) integrated with a phototransistor, and housed in an isolation package. The LED is used to emit light in response to a signal input, which then activates the phototransistor, allowing current to flow from its collector to its emitter. When currents of sufficient magnitude are applied to the LED, light is emitted and travels across the “insulating” barrier. The light activates the phototransistor, and a current flow can be established between the collector and emitter in the output circuit. Light is then blocked by the insulating package, preventing any current from being able to flow between the input and output circuits.

Thus, when the LED is energized, the phototransistor is activated. This allows electrical signals from the input circuit to be transferred to the output circuit, creating the aforementioned “isolation” between them.
